MBH5 Group Two – Block #2 – “All Stars” by Me, Lisa Bongean!

Hey Blockheads! Ready for your next MBH5 assignment? I’m proud to say that this week’s block comes from yours truly, Lisa Bongean! The pattern was particularly fun for me to dream up because if you know me at all, you know I am definitely a quilter who loves stars and half-square triangles equally. Conveniently enough for me, most star blocks just so happen to be made up of half-square triangles so obviously, this made my block “All Stars” a joy for me to design, and even more fun for me to put together.

Not a fan of half-square triangles? Don’t worry, this is actually great timing! My block, “All Stars” is a fun way to try your hand at one of the best quilting hacks ever discovered – triangle paper! My custom designed Primitive Gatherings Triangle Paper will make your fear of the infamous HST a thing of the past. If you need to see the proof in the pudding, take my blocks for instance. I used 1″ Triangle Paper for the 6″ blocks, and 2″ Triangle Paper for the 12″ blocks, which made them super easy and fast to make. Ready to give Triangle Paper a try? In case you’re wondering, for my blocks I’m using Bella Solid Silver (9900 183) for the background of my quilt, and Bella Solid American Blue (9900 174) consistently throughout the entire thing. The additional warmer selections are from the same soft, muted collection of Bella Solids that we put together for this project called “Sundown.” The entire collection is available for purchase on our website by clicking the buttons below!
